Population standard deviation
- Step 1: Calculate the mean of the data—this is μ in the formula.
- Step 2: Subtract the mean from each data point.
- Step 3: Square each deviation to make it positive.
- Step 4: Add the squared deviations together.
- Step 5: Divide the sum by the number of data points in the population.
How do you solve a two sample z-test?
How do I run a Z Test?
- State the null hypothesis and alternate hypothesis.
- Choose an alpha level.
- Find the critical value of z in a z table.
- Calculate the z test statistic (see below).
- Compare the test statistic to the critical z value and decide if you should support or reject the null hypothesis.

What is the mean and standard deviation of the distribution of z scores?
The mean of the z-scores is always 0. The standard deviation of the z-scores is always 1. The sum of the squared z-scores is always equal to the number of z-score values. Z-scores above 0 represent sample values above the mean, while z-scores below 0 represent sample values below the mean.
What is two sample z-test used for?
The Two-Sample Z-test is used to compare the means of two samples to see if it is feasible that they come from the same population. The null hypothesis is: the population means are equal.

What is the purpose of two sample Z test for proportions?
When to use Two Sample Z Proportion test The purpose of two sample Z test is to compare the random samples of two populations. Use two sample z test of proportion for large sample size and Fisher exact probability test is an excellent non-parametric test for small sample sizes.
What is 2 sample z test used for?
The z-Test: Two- Sample for Means tool runs a two sample z-Test means with known variances to test the null hypothesis that there is no difference between the means of two independent populations. This tool can be used to run a one-sided or two-sided test z-test. Two P values are calculated in the output of this test.

What is Z test of proportions?
z test for difference of proportions is used to test the hypothesis that two populations have the same proportion. For example suppose one is interested to test if there is any significant difference in the habit of tea drinking between male and female citizens of a town.
What is a 2 proportion z test?
This tests for a difference in proportions. A two proportion z-test allows you to compare two proportions to see if they are the same. The null hypothesis (H 0) for the test is that the proportions are the same. The alternate hypothesis (H 1) is that the proportions are not the same.
